The EcoCruiser would be a derivative of the Solar Wingsail Cruiser, differing primarily in that it employs a larger vessel scale and a predominate use of active propulsion in the form of a sophisticated electric drive system and power plant using renewable energy packaged as a fuel such as liquid hydrogen, biofuels like methanol, hydrides, or redox solutions. Depending on type of energy packaging medium, power plants may use either fuel cells or turbogenerators with these possibly being traded-off as the marine settlement evolves its energy production capability.
